VOT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2018 in Review

377 of the 4,374 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Vanguard Mid-Cap Growth ETF (VOT) for Q3 2018, worth a combined $2.72B — up 9.5% from $2.49B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 35 funds opened new VOT positions and 16 closed out — a net gain of 19 holders — while 128 added to existing stakes and 103 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Bank of America, adding an estimated $23.4M. The largest seller was Cornerstone Wealth Management, cutting an estimated $10.9M.
